How to Use WHM to Customise the cPanel User Interface

This article explains how to customise your hosting customers’ user interface. You can simply brand cPanel using Web Host Manager (WHM) to display your logos, different styles, and more. WHM is used for rebranding and customizing cPanel for your customers.

Changes such as the logos of the company, the style of interface, and its appearance.

The steps to customize a customer’s user interface in cPanel using WHM are as follows:

  1. Log in to the WHM.

  2. From the left-hand side menu, select cPanel. Click the “Customization” option under cPanel.

  3. You will enter the “Customization” page. Here, you can see the tabs one after the other.
  4. Firstly select the “Customize Branding” tab. Fill in the company name, help link, documentation link, then company logo, webmail logo, favicon, and finally hit the “Save” button.

  5. Now, select the second tab of “Customize Style”. You can select the style of your choice.

  6. Now, you are in the final stage of customization. Select the “Public contact” tab. Write down the Public company name and public contact URL and hit the “Save” button.
